Clarisse thinks education is incredibly important. However, she does not go to school because in this society, people are not taught to think for themselves. They are taught to be automatons. So, Clarisse won't get anything of intellectual value from the schools in this society.
Explanation:
Clarisse explain her typical school day to Montag , which doesn't involve any academics at all , first, she has an hour of a class about TV, she then has an hour-long sports class , after which she has a painting class, a transcription history class, or another sports class.
